From a16eb6190c956c8935aaff55eec40ad42734b1ca Mon Sep 17 00:00:00 2001 From: Rafael Espindola Date: Mon, 2 Nov 2015 13:30:46 +0000 Subject: [PATCH] This doesn't need a object::Archive::child_iterator. git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@251796 91177308-0d34-0410-b5e6-96231b3b80d8 --- tools/llvm-ar/llvm-ar.cpp |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/tools/llvm-ar/llvm-ar.cpp b/tools/llvm-ar/llvm-ar.cpp index 42c95814ae6..f0e7284d9b9 100644 --- a/tools/llvm-ar/llvm-ar.cpp +++ b/tools/llvm-ar/llvm-ar.cpp @@ -466,7 +466,7 @@ enum InsertAction { }; static InsertAction computeInsertAction(ArchiveOperation Operation, - object::Archive::child_iterator I, + const object::Archive::Child &Member, StringRef Name, std::vector::iterator &Pos) { if (Operation == QuickAppend || Members.empty()) @@ -500,7 +500,7 @@ static InsertAction computeInsertAction(ArchiveOperation Operation, // operation. sys::fs::file_status Status; failIfError(sys::fs::status(*MI, Status), *MI); - if (Status.getLastModificationTime() < I->getLastModified()) { + if (Status.getLastModificationTime() < Member.getLastModified()) { if (PosName.empty()) return IA_AddOldMember; return IA_MoveOldMember; -- 2.34.1